1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a chemical reaction?

Back

A process where substances (reactants) undergo a transformation to form new substances (products).

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a physical change?

Back

A change that affects one or more physical properties of a substance without altering its chemical composition.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Give an example of a physical change.

Back

Freezing water is an example of a physical change.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What are the properties of matter?

Back

Properties of matter include magnetism, color, odor, density, and mass.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a catalyst?

Back

A substance that increases the rate of a chemical reaction without being consumed in the process.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What happens to atoms in a chemical reaction?

Back

Atoms are rearranged to form new substances, but the total number of atoms remains the same.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the law of conservation of mass?

Back

In a chemical reaction, mass is neither created nor destroyed; it is conserved.
